247SportsReport: Mississippi State looking to hire Packers WR coach247SportsLuke Getsy could be leaving the Green Bay Packers after this season. According to Football Scoop, new Mississippi State Joe Moorhead is looking to hire Getsy as his new offensive coordinator.
